FleishmanHillard has an immediate opening for a Senior Vice President in its TRUE Global Intelligence (TGI) practice. The role is based in one of our core offices in New York, Los Angeles, San Francisco or Washington D.C. The TGI practice serves as a strategic consultancy within the broader organization, harnessing research and data‑driven insights to achieve client business objectives. Work within TGI combines measurement, primary research, secondary research methods, AI integrations, advanced data analytics and strategic consulting.

Overview

The Senior Vice President must have demonstrable healthcare expertise, a deep understanding of key trends in the healthcare landscape, therapeutic areas, business models and regulatory environment, and must be able to position research and analytics strategically to healthcare clients. The core focus of this role is to grow TGI’s footprint among the firm’s healthcare and life sciences (H&LS) clients, identify expansion opportunities, build trust‑based relationships, and align research with the overall client strategy.
